View from the East Wing
Jill Biden became First Lady at a complicated moment—at the height of COVID-19 and in the shadow of January 6—and hit the ground running. A tireless advocate for women's health, military families, cancer initiatives and education, she made history as the first First Lady to hold an outside job while in the White House, continuing to teach at a nearby community college. Yet she always saw herself as an ordinary woman living an extraordinary life. In View from the East Wing, Jill shares her White House experiences for the first time—from Camp David to Air Force One, from grading papers in the Rose Garden to witnessing the abrupt end of her husband's bid for reelection. A story of a woman devoted to her roles as wife, mother, grandmother, teacher—and First Lady.

The Book of Birds
The Book of Birds is a field guide with a difference: It shows readers not just how to identify birds, but also how to identifywith them. Robert Macfarlane and Jackie Morris conjure the unique spirit of nearly fifty once-common species—avocet to yellowhammer, kestrel to kingfisher, skylark to nightingale. In lyrical and incantatory essays, Macfarlane describes each bird’s habits and habitats, their patterns of flight and patterns of song, how they hunt or fish or scavenge or gather, how they nest and raise their chicks, the myths that attend them, the threats that shadow them—and how their lives intersect with our own. On every page we encounter Morris’s exhilarating artwork, painted from life in watercolor and gold leaf, and animated with an extraordinary attention to detail.The Book of Birds is a love letter to the thrilling variety and mysteries of birdlife, and a clarion call to halt the rapid depletion of our skies.
The Wreck of the Mentor
In 1832, the American whaleship Mentor is wrecked on a remote Pacific reef. The eleven surviving crewmen face not only the miseries of shipwreck but an uncertain encounter with the Indigenous people of Palau—who approach them brandishing axes, clubs, and spears. Award-winning historian Eric Jay Dolin reconstructs the doomed voyage, the years of perilous captivity, and the fraught naval rescue that followed. Illustrated with more than 100 images and maps, The Wreck of the Mentor is a gripping tale of survival, cultural collision, and maritime ambition—from the bestselling author of Black Flags, Blue Waters.
